Do you want to present data and also impress your audience? A tool that has been available for some time is Trandanalyzer. I have (a bit late, I admit) started to use Trandanalyzer and I must say that this is really useful in many cases, not just for just for web metrics.
Take a look at: http://www.gapminder.org/ for very inspiring examples and if you havent seen his presentations, Hans Rosling is a role-model for data visualization.
Do you want to do your own visualizations, take a look at:
http://www.gapminder.org/upload-data/motion-chart/
More advanced users can do much more advanced things using the Google visualization API (some of my collegues at Acando is using this), se http://code.google.com/intl/sv/apis/visualization/documentation/gadgetgallery.htm for more on that topic.
